Output 21611432f6d49a9cb687d65450ded5136a0a46c4dcd597ef73a6702f07b4bb3b:0

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d957279aebc52a2dd3da1d73cada8b328666c2 OP_EQUAL
address
3FMLyCska1qvwNVLa77zSMdCYREqCNveCC
transaction
21611432f6d49a9cb687d65450ded5136a0a46c4dcd597ef73a6702f07b4bb3b
confirmations
131518
spent
true